A New Economy for the New Dominion

Today, Mike released his jobs plan, "A New Economy for the New Dominion."  Check out the video below and view then view the full plan.

With this dynamic, creative approach to the office of Lieutenant Governor, Mike will fight to help Virginia will create or save at least 50,000 jobs by 2011 in the following seven sectors:   

  1. Low-Tech and High-Tech Infrastructure Jobs
  2. Energy Efficiency
  3. Smart Grid Jobs
  4. Health IT Jobs
  5. Rural Tourism Jobs
  6. Military Construction Jobs
  7. Environmental Restoration Jobs
